Post Special Alumni Initiation?

Question for all you Chi-O's out there:

I have someone very close to me and my family that pledged Chi Omega in college, but never initiated. She was VERY involved in the sorority during her time, but financial hardships forced her to leave school before she initiated. She is now 26, married and a mother. She often speaks about her days in the sorority, and I can tell that it bothers her that she never initiated.

My question is does Chi Omega have any special initiate process that women who are no longer in college could be initiated? I know my own fraternity, Pi Kappa Alpha, has a Special Initiate program where we can initiate men that were either never in a college fraternity, or had once pledged Pike but not initiated.

I have looked at the Chi-O national webpage and came up empty for my search for a Special Initiate program, so I was hoping some of you Sisters out there could shed some light on the subject.

Amy is correct - I contacted headquarters today and this is what they said...

Absolutely. Chi Omega offers an opportunity for women who were not
members of a Greek group to become Initiated members. This process is
called "Special Initiation." If you can give the young lady my name and
phone number, I will visit with her about this opportunity.
